The Front Naked Choke is a highly effective submission technique in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u (BJJ) that can quickly render an opponent unconscious if executed correctly. This technique is commonly used from the top position, particularly when the practitioner has established a dominant control over their opponent's upper body. The Front Naked Choke involves wrapping one arm around the opponent's neck, placing the bicep against one side of their neck and the forearm against the other side. The practitioner then secures the choke by clasping their own hands together, creating a tight and unbreakable grip. By applying pressure with the arms and squeezing the opponent's carotid arteries, blood flow to the brain is restricted, leading to a loss of consciousness if the choke is not released in time.

1. What is a Front Naked Choke in BJJ?
A Front Naked Choke is a submission technique used in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u (BJJ) where the attacker wraps their arm around the opponent's neck from the front and applies pressure to cut off the blood flow to the brain, resulting in a potential chokehold.

3. Is the Front Naked Choke a safe technique to practice in BJJ?
When executed correctly and with proper control, the Front Naked Choke can be a safe technique to practice in BJJ. However, it is essential to train under the guidance of a skilled instructor and always prioritize the safety and well-being of your training partner. Proper communication, understanding of the technique, and gradual progression in applying pressure are crucial to ensure a safe training environment.
